Output 533a76a0957178fe3aaefb02152fecea2e62d82e8c05c53122f1cf1aac21c0fd:18

value
525531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76592b55272e930fd07864ba3c28ac7b4935fb6 OP_EQUAL
address
3QF8WM62eMRWbMhgsz9X4Ps9drmsa3YzjZ
transaction
533a76a0957178fe3aaefb02152fecea2e62d82e8c05c53122f1cf1aac21c0fd
confirmations
48523
spent
true